#include <Wire.h>
|
||||
#include "Adafruit_MPR121.h"
|
||||
|
||||
#ifndef _BV
|
||||
#define _BV(bit) (1 << (bit))
|
||||
#endif
|
||||
|
||||
// You can have up to 4 on one i2c bus but one is enough for testing!
|
||||
Adafruit_MPR121 cap = Adafruit_MPR121();
|
||||
|
||||
// Keeps track of the last pins touched
|
||||
// so we know when buttons are 'released'
|
||||
uint16_t lasttouched = 0;
|
||||
uint16_t currtouched = 0;
|
||||
|
||||
void setup() {
|
||||
Serial.begin(9600);
|
||||
|
||||
while (!Serial) { // needed to keep leonardo/micro from starting too fast!
|
||||
delay(10);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
Serial.println("Adafruit MPR121 Capacitive Touch sensor test");
|
||||
|
||||
// Default address is 0x5A, if tied to 3.3V its 0x5B
|
||||
// If tied to SDA its 0x5C and if SCL then 0x5D
|
||||
if (!cap.begin(0x5A)) {
|
||||
Serial.println("MPR121 not found, check wiring?");
|
||||
while (1);
|
||||
}
|
||||
Serial.println("MPR121 found!");
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
void loop() {
|
||||
// Get the currently touched pads
|
||||
currtouched = cap.touched();
|
||||
|
||||
for (uint8_t i=0; i<12; i++) {
|
||||
// it if *is* touched and *wasnt* touched before, alert!
|
||||
if ((currtouched & _BV(i)) && !(lasttouched & _BV(i)) ) {
|
||||
Serial.print(i); Serial.println(" touched");
|
||||
}
|
||||
// if it *was* touched and now *isnt*, alert!
|
||||
if (!(currtouched & _BV(i)) && (lasttouched & _BV(i)) ) {
|
||||
Serial.print(i); Serial.println(" released");
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// reset our state
|
||||
lasttouched = currtouched;
|
||||
|
||||
// comment out this line for detailed data from the sensor!
|
||||
return;
|
||||
|
||||
// debugging info, what
|
||||
Serial.print("\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t 0x"); Serial.println(cap.touched(), HEX);
|
||||
Serial.print("Filt: ");
|
||||
for (uint8_t i=0; i<12; i++) {
|
||||
Serial.print(cap.filteredData(i)); Serial.print("\t");
|
||||
}
|
||||
Serial.println();
|
||||
Serial.print("Base: ");
|
||||
for (uint8_t i=0; i<12; i++) {
|
||||
Serial.print(cap.baselineData(i)); Serial.print("\t");
|
||||
}
|
||||
Serial.println();
|
||||
|
||||
// put a delay so it isn't overwhelming
|
||||
delay(100);
|
||||
}
